A platform for monitoring long Covid patients planned before the end of the year

The platform for monitoring patients suffering from long Covid will be planned before the end of the year. Parliament had definitively adopted the UDI bill on January 13, 2022, by a vote of the Senate. The implementing decrees have not yet been published. The platform will be used to better care for people suffering from the disease.

The “Covid long” affected 4% of adults in France, or 2.06 million people, a small proportion (1.2%) declaring themselves very embarrassed in their daily activities, according to a study by Public Health France carried out at l fall 2022.

The platform will allow people to be better informed, better followed

“The implementation of this platform should happen before the end of the year” and “will allow people to be better informed, better followed and to know near them what the possibilities of care are”, has said Renaissance MP Stéphanie Rist, also general rapporteur of the Social Affairs Committee, on franceinfo.

“But, already, there may be recognition of long-term illness for certain long Covids or occupational disease management. There is no need to wait for these decrees, ”said the elected representative of Loiret and doctor. The care of patients with long Covid can go through the attending physician, she noted.

“Long Covid patients must not be forgotten by the crisis”

“It is important to already take into account medically these long Covids, these are symptoms that are not very specific (fatigue, joint pain, etc.) to a disease but which lead to a very significant incapacity in life. As a rheumatologist, I see him regularly,” said Stéphanie Rist.

The High Authority for Health must also “soon publish a care guide”, according to her, “research continues”, she observed. “Long Covid patients must not be forgotten by the crisis”, judged the deputy. But “in the field, we still have great difficulty in recognition, there are still many doctors who do not know what long Covid is, who do not believe their patients”, lamented the president of the association. of patients “After D20”, Pauline Oustric, at the microphone of franceinfo. His association wants “homogenized recognition in occupational disease” and facilitated.
